  • Patent number: 9289888
    Abstract: The invention relates to a novel screw tensioning device with a screw tensioning cylinder with a high-pressure hydraulic pump for pretensioning screws and loosening extremely secure pretensable screw connections and an accompanying control method. The problem is to create a screw tensioning device that can generate high tensioning forces, that requires less energy, that can be used for all usage locations without problems, that can be easily controlled and that makes precisely controlled pretensioning possible. A high-pressure hydraulic pump 39 is integrated into the interior of the screw tensioning cylinder 38 in accordance with the invention. This high-pressure pump 39 is connected to a sealed hydraulic accumulator 42. A drive unit 40 that can be pneumatically actuated is arranged on or in the screw tensioning cylinder 38. The drive unit 40 can be designed on the constructional basis of a diaphragm cylinder 42 or on the basis of a piston cylinder.
